Comment by SCdF 1 day ago
I don't know why they think this, but no? Perhaps it's badly expressed, but LLMs cut corners all the time. It's sort of their core fault really.
Anyway, I disagree with the core premise[1]. Re-writes are not cheap, because 1) code can be so bad it's unclear how to rewrite it[2], b) code can be so significant it's challenging to rewrite it (architectural choices, schemas, etc), and lastly if you're ever wanting to own your own code and not rent it from LLM companies, having it understandable by a human is still a goal worth working toward.
[1] To be fair, I think OP _might_ be talking about rewriting in the moment of the thing being built, but with some unspoken rule that once they think the change is good enough, then they are reviewing all the code? They don't make it clear..
[2] it's not even that hard. Write a test that exercises an end result and not the rule that causes that end result and 6 months later you've forgotten why the code is like that. I had to maintain a piece of software once where the primary form of tests were a bunch of snapshots of an end report being generated, based on some initial data input, mostly all unlabeled. The code was like "do this SQL query on table A and then take the second result". Why the second result? Your guess is as good as mine! I couldn't even work out why they were querying table A and not table B...

Comment by LoganDark 1 day ago
The nature of probabilistic sampling practically guarantees that corner cutting is always just a few samples away. Certain sampling strategies can mitigate this, but there's no way to fully eliminate it, without fully eliminating it from the training data and guarding against it during training. Model reasoning can help by giving the model space to draft and review its approach before it executes, but models still aren't guaranteed to follow their own thinking. A mistake or shortcut can always simply slip in during generation and it won't always be caught and corrected.

Comment by LoganDark 22 hours ago
- Good logits and sampling strategy can make cases like those exceptionally unlikely -- sufficiently so for one to assume it won't realistically happen.
- Once a bad path is sufficiently taken, it tends to be a lot more likely to continue.
This leads to real-world advice:
- If a model refuses your request, do not argue with the refusal; edit your original message or otherwise regenerate -- the presence of refusal tells the model it should continue refusing.
- More generally, don't allow the model context to get contaminated with behavior or commands you don't like -- describing what to do is more effective than describing what NOT to do.
- It's rude to push unreviewed model outputs onto others.
I'm not saying corner-cutting is a thing that is necessarily all over the place (even though there are countless examples in the wild). I'm also not saying it always results in random stops, or that doing one thing bad makes everything else bad. What I'm saying is that bad decisions could be hidden anywhere, at any time, even if everything else looks fine. Such is the nature of current LLMs.

Say you discover in review that your agent wrote code before tests. A file that was added, no corresponding test file.
Tell the agent to read in the file, delete it (or roll back), then reimplement using red/green TDD.
Claude can test-drive an identical reimplementation but this time by writing red tests and making them green. Now you have coverage that you KNOW covers the code because you watched those tests fail before they passed.
Going further I added a note to my `/review` command so the agent looks for this mistake for me in its self-review. If it finds uncovered code it makes a plan which includes the delete-reimplement trick. Now all I do is approve that plan - no hunting needed, no explaining, no repeating myself.
You could even put this in a Ralph Wiggum loop and give yourself super high quality tests by going file by file.
